Пытаюсь отобразить товары плиткой, шорткод тупо отображается его текст.
Просто шорткод [productlist] - работает.
Вставляю шоркод из примера: [productlist type='list' inpage='15' cat='30,45' desc='350'] а он не работает (отображается на странице просто текстом).
Думал может синтаксис где не правильный, поменял оператор в type - чтоб плиткой отображал - все равно не работает
И еще вопрос - вот смотрю я на товаров список, и когда кликаю на позиции, выводится цена, фото и текст, но те дополнительные данные из формы, не видны. Как настроить так чтобы они были видны - в них и условия доставки, и сопутствующая информация, и пр.?
Павел Кривенко сказал(а)
[ productlist ] работает, а расширенный шорткод нет.
Что за "расширенный шорткод"?
Поля заполняемые при публикации, я так понимаю, это произвольные поля публикации.
Чтобы вывести все данные занесенные в созданные произвольные поля формы публикации внутри опубликованной записи можно воспользоваться функцией
rcl_get_custom_post_meta($post_id)
Разместите ее внутри цикла и передайте ей идентификатор записи первым аргументом
Также можно вывести каждое произвольное поле в отдельности через функцию
get_post_meta($post_id,$slug,1)
где
$post_id - идентификатор записи
$slug - ярлык произвольного поля формы
Вот этот шоркод - [ add-basket ] - он просто отображается текстом. Не могу разобраться, какие настройки позволяют его активировать.
> Поля заполняемые при публикации, я так понимаю, это произвольные поля публикации.
Да, они самые.
> Чтобы вывести все данные занесенные в созданные произвольные поля формы публикации внутри опубликованной записи можно воспользоваться функцией rcl_get_custom_post_meta($post_id) Разместите ее внутри цикла и передайте ей идентификатор записи первым аргументом Также можно вывести каждое произвольное поле в отдельности через функцию get_post_meta($post_id,$slug,1) где $post_id - идентификатор записи $slug - ярлык произвольного поля формы
Ок! Спасибо, буду пробовать вставить!
Otshelnik-Fm сказал(а)
перед скобками пробелов быть не должно. Шорткод требует активированного дополнения - магазин
Да, про пробелы я давно уяснил 🙂
Андрей Plechev сказал(а)
в настройках магазина укажите вывод кнопки "В корзину" - через шорткод
Да, указал. Теперь на тестовой странице, шоркот не выводится текстом. Но так и не понял - как его использовать? Я думал размещаешь материал, текстовую страницу, указываешь шорткод, и можно приобрести тот материал на который ведет ссылка. Но пока не разобрал, а из описания не все понял - как его использовать. Остальное все работает. Осталось поля впихнуть, и перейду к бирже - приобрету и буду с ней осваиваться.
Страница должна быть из Товаров (таксономия)
Я проверил
1 .в настройках магазина указал вывод корзины шорткодом
2. в товарах создал товар, картинку описание
3 там же указал шорткод.
4. опубликовал - кнопка в корзину выводится.
Что вы делаете не так?
уже разобрался, все работает. Я просто думал что можно произвольно на странице разместить шоркод, чтобы после покупки приходила ссылка. Но это видимо из другой оперы. А так - да, все работает. Но не увидел для себя смысла, т.к. при автоматическом размещении, эта кнопка присутствует автоматически.